mercurial/setdiscovery.py
483d47753726d3ce75014afb622e36cf177c3eb6
created 2017-06-10 18:47 +0100
pushed 2017-06-15 18:20 +0000
Pierre-Yves David Pierre-Yves David - setdiscovery: improves logged message
28240b75e880ee24b89789bb2d5f159354b52e2b
created 2017-06-07 10:44 +0100
pushed 2017-06-15 18:20 +0000
Pierre-Yves David Pierre-Yves David - discovery: log discovery result in non-trivial cases
43bda143e3b2a75a79df102ef228620425ccfcc4
created 2017-06-07 10:29 +0100
pushed 2017-06-15 18:20 +0000
Pierre-Yves David Pierre-Yves David - discovery: include timing in the debug output
4adb9494797afc2b7daae120339d88a4700230fc
created 2015-10-09 17:43 -0700
pushed 2016-07-18 18:37 +0000
Gregory Szorc Gregory Szorc - HACK discovery on push optimization draft
c3eacee01c7ebc8808e3ca596acf26912baf446d
created 2016-03-01 17:44 -0500
pushed 2016-03-12 00:54 +0000
Augie Fackler Augie Fackler - setdiscovery: use iterbatch interface instead of batch
56b2bcea252913e4a2d2772d2f35cd7e07b37f12
created 2015-10-08 12:55 -0700
pushed 2015-10-13 18:48 +0000
Pierre-Yves David Pierre-Yves David - error: get Abort from 'error' instead of 'util'
6dc58916e7c070f678682bfe404d2e2d68291a18
created 2014-11-20 09:42 -0800
pushed 2015-08-22 18:19 +0000
Gregory Szorc Gregory Szorc - setdiscovery.findcommonheads: examine ancestors to avoid discovery draft
6e7ea082099e457b048f268751d345392653e97e
created 2014-11-20 09:23 -0800
pushed 2015-08-22 18:19 +0000
Gregory Szorc Gregory Szorc - setdiscovery.findcommonheads: communicate wanted nodes draft
fb5664eb8414fee21d7ad87fd246706ae0a0e1f8
created 2015-08-08 19:53 -0700
pushed 2015-08-10 22:46 +0000
Gregory Szorc Gregory Szorc - setdiscovery: use absolute_import
4d77e89652ad72bd303201a289df0276deb9fd3f
created 2015-08-05 14:21 -0400
pushed 2015-08-10 22:46 +0000
Augie Fackler Augie Fackler - discovery: always use batching now that all peers support batching
927a6706a886eead39bcc704793be5cdb09fcb25
created 2015-06-21 22:04 -0700
pushed 2015-06-22 07:28 +0000
Gregory Szorc Gregory Szorc - setdiscovery: use absolute import
6eb4bdad198f546de7a5b06602119a27b5bc3203
created 2015-05-16 14:34 -0400
pushed 2015-05-26 00:39 +0000
Augie Fackler Augie Fackler - cleanup: use __builtins__.all instead of util.all
0ca8410ea3455bcef5b9335ca6d9aa2de4adc2c9
created 2015-05-16 11:28 -0700
pushed 2015-05-26 00:39 +0000
Martin von Zweigbergk Martin von Zweigbergk - util: drop alias for collections.deque
813aaaf2aff38b4d3e7ff9e4b6f1dc5d79f84745
created 2015-01-06 17:19 -0800
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- setdiscovery: remove '_setupsample' function
34d4b58580d1a8dfa02f95589928baf62463157e
created 2015-01-07 20:44 -0800
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- setdiscovery: document '_takequicksample'
31e75a362d44b1826a8d269a0f2a38d2d50918c3
created 2015-01-06 17:07 -0800
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- setdiscovery: drop '_setupsample' usage in '_takequicksample'
6a5877a73141448e6d91bc74e53808b428357e41
created 2015-01-07 10:32 -0800
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- setdiscovery: drop the 'always' argument to '_updatesample'
932f814bf01635c327570cf61c0ac3cae4718db4
created 2015-01-07 17:28 -0800
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- setdiscovery: always add exponential sample to the heads
db58186dd8e3ad35fb451916c262a43a6e7d524e
created 2015-01-07 17:23 -0800
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- setdiscovery: directly run '_updatesample'
e2b262e2ee73f4db6867ec60e98ce766e5f3d095
created 2015-01-07 17:17 -0800
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- setdiscovery: stop using '_setupsample' in '_takefullsample'
b681d3a2bf04ad135de5b09e2918ac0da3fdc593
created 2015-01-07 12:09 -0800
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- setdiscovery: randomly pick between heads and sample when taking full sample
9ca2eb881b53656bf7b763dddb12a1510c5c8a2f
created 2015-01-06 17:02 -0800
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- setdiscovery: document the '_updatesample' function
07d0f59e0ba7a9992d203868528c48694f826b19
created 2015-01-06 16:40 -0800
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- setdiscovery: avoid calling any sample building if the undecided set is small
e97e363a7000817dcad4d05caddfbbec44dfc897
created 2015-01-07 09:30 -0800
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- setdiscovery: delay sample building calls to gather them in a single place
d6cbbe3baef0f8c9435675b83c09eb3bba764d88
created 2015-01-06 16:32 -0800
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- setdiscovery: drop unused 'initial' argument for '_takequicksample'
f82173a90c2c9d0d32216fe7243ec51fc6d44ff7
created 2015-01-06 16:30 -0800
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- setdiscovery: factorize similar sampling code
4ef2f2fa8b8b27daf21375017f5646b3277d35cc
created 2015-01-06 16:30 -0800
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- setdiscovery: drop shadowed 'undecided' assignment
f8a2647fe020da7bf68e12083f10bef9183e7ee3
created 2014-11-16 00:40 -0800
pushed 2015-03-18 16:34 +0000
Siddharth Agarwal Siddharth Agarwal - setdiscovery: avoid a full changelog graph traversal
73cfaa34865061744250a63ed01e970ad7a4bf3d
created 2014-11-05 13:05 +0100
pushed 2015-03-18 16:34 +0000
Mads Kiilerich Mads Kiilerich - discovery: indices between sample and yesno must match (issue4438) stable
86c35b7ae300358c2a6fb18580970ae55f075ed7
created 2014-11-05 13:05 +0100
pushed 2015-03-18 16:34 +0000
Mads Kiilerich Mads Kiilerich - discovery: limit 'all local heads known remotely' to real 'all' (issue4438) stable
ced632394371a36953ce4d394f86278ae51a2aae
created 2014-11-01 23:52 +0000
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- setdiscovery: limit the size of all sample (issue4411) stable 3.2
3ef893520a85a881680b5128a7e0c399aaf2f6bb
created 2014-10-27 17:52 +0100
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- setdiscovery: limit the size of the initial sample (issue4411) stable
ee45f5c2ffcc7d1a09306b334eaba4b5bfdd74e7
created 2014-10-27 17:40 +0100
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- setdiscovery: extract sample limitation in a `_limitsample` function stable
cdecbc5ab5044595ca2d820a1b4933b5ec77c248
created 2014-03-06 12:37 +0100
pushed 2015-03-18 16:34 +0000
Olle Lundberg Olle Lundberg - setdiscovery: document algorithms used
1e5b38a919dd460ec7602dbd7c5d33bbdd008fb1
created 2013-11-06 16:48 -0500
pushed 2015-03-18 16:34 +0000
Augie Fackler Augie Fackler - cleanup: move stdlib imports to their own import statement
9724f8f8850b9979d5d30c626bea81d625b16c36
created 2012-08-21 02:41 +0200
pushed 2015-03-18 16:34 +0000
Mads Kiilerich Mads Kiilerich - delete some dead comments and docstrings
e7cfe3587ea46140d24ad26a2c21441409f52608
created 2012-08-15 22:38 +0200
pushed 2015-03-18 16:34 +0000
Mads Kiilerich Mads Kiilerich - fix trivial spelling errors
4feb55e6931f634e9b910514b8e64ca66193e69b
created 2012-07-17 01:04 +0200
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- localpeer: return only visible heads and branchmap
5884812686f76eeb0c6c4bd100b2ee0f33f8fa6a
created 2012-07-13 21:46 +0200
pushed 2015-03-18 16:34 +0000
Sune Foldager Sune Foldager - peer: introduce peer methods to prepare for peer classes
cafd8a8fb7131449ab5e6a03bcbb87134455f2ad
created 2012-06-01 17:05 -0700
pushed 2015-03-18 16:34 +0000
Bryan O'Sullivan Bryan O'Sullivan - util: subclass deque for Python 2.4 backwards compatibility
525fdb7389757cdb7dbbac1ef865d79dc0ea789c
created 2012-05-12 15:54 +0200
pushed 2015-03-18 16:34 +0000
Brodie Rao Brodie Rao - cleanup: eradicate long lines
cff25e4b37d20f5ecf1acac63cf7b52717b735be
created 2011-12-22 00:42 +0100
pushed 2015-03-18 16:34 +0000
Pierre-Yves David Pierre-Yves David - phases: do not exchange secret changesets
9bea3aed6ee17622c4f5f2333fa7a1a24e7480fb
created 2011-11-11 01:07 +0100
pushed 2015-03-18 16:34 +0000
Mads Kiilerich Mads Kiilerich - add missing localization markup stable
c20688b7c06129f6fa23d53b7c927f9e79b5b313
created 2011-08-25 21:25 +0200
pushed 2015-03-18 16:34 +0000
Peter Arrenbrecht Peter Arrenbrecht - setdiscovery: fix hang when #heads>200 (issue2971) stable
192e02680d094dc22cf856e70f07348bd6de18d1
created 2011-07-27 18:32 -0400
pushed 2015-03-18 16:34 +0000
Andrew Pritchard Andrew Pritchard - setdiscovery: return anyincoming=False when remote's only head is nullid stable
308e1b5acc87fe019b8691166484bcdc29999c4c
created 2011-07-05 14:30 -0500
pushed 2015-03-18 16:34 +0000
Matt Mackall Matt Mackall - discovery: quiet note about heads stable
f03c82d1f50acbc368a7b1b9bb16a9e1cd169b59
created 2011-06-14 22:58 +0200
pushed 2015-03-18 16:34 +0000
Peter Arrenbrecht Peter Arrenbrecht - setdiscovery: batch heads and known(ownheads)
2bf60f158ecb46a538e130f1e610db21f9a557fa
created 2011-05-05 23:21 +0800
pushed 2015-03-18 16:34 +0000
Steven Brown Steven Brown - setdiscovery: limit lines to 80 characters
cb98fed5249517b558fa07c7d0414c14cdfe4e4d
created 2011-05-02 19:21 +0200
pushed 2015-03-18 16:34 +0000
Peter Arrenbrecht Peter Arrenbrecht - discovery: add new set-based discovery
less more (0) tip